How to fill out vendorpermit

How to fill out a vendor permit?
01
First, gather all the necessary information and documents that may be required for the vendor permit application process. This may include identification proof, business licenses, tax identification numbers, and any other relevant paperwork.
02
Research the specific requirements and guidelines for obtaining a vendor permit in your jurisdiction. Different cities, states, or countries may have varying regulations, so it is crucial to familiarize yourself with the specific rules that apply to your situation.
03
Complete the application form accurately and thoroughly. Be sure to provide all the requested information, including your personal details, business name and address, contact information, and any other required details. Double-check the form for any errors or missing information before submitting it.
04
Attach all the necessary supporting documents to your application. This may include copies of your identification, business licenses, tax documents, or any other paperwork requested by the issuing authority. Make sure to organize and label these documents appropriately to avoid any confusion or delays in the application process.
05
Pay the required fees associated with the vendor permit application. The amount and payment methods might vary, so follow the instructions provided by the issuing authority. Keep a record of the payment transaction for future reference.
06
Submit the completed application form and supporting documents to the designated office or department responsible for processing vendor permits. This can usually be done in person, by mail, or online, depending on the available options provided by the issuing authority. Ensure that you meet any deadlines and follow any specific submission instructions.
Who needs a vendor permit?
01
Individuals or businesses that engage in selling goods or services in public spaces, such as markets, street fairs, or parks, often require a vendor permit. The specific requirements may vary depending on the location and nature of the business.
02
Food vendors, including those operating food trucks or stalls, generally need a separate permit, often referred to as a food vendor permit or a mobile food vendor permit. This ensures that they meet health and safety regulations when preparing and selling food to the public.
03
Non-profit organizations or charitable groups conducting fundraising activities, such as bake sales or charity events, may also need a vendor permit in certain jurisdictions. These permits are typically obtained to ensure compliance with local regulations and to maintain transparency in business operations.
In summary, filling out a vendor permit involves collecting the required documents, accurately completing the application form, attaching supporting paperwork, paying the necessary fees, and submitting the application to the appropriate authority. Vendor permits are typically necessary for individuals or businesses selling goods or services in public spaces, including food vendors and non-profit organizations conducting fundraising activities. Always check and adhere to the specific requirements and guidelines of your jurisdiction.

What is vendorpermit?
Vendor permit is a document or license that allows individuals or businesses to sell goods or services in a specific location.
Who is required to file vendorpermit?
Individuals or businesses that wish to sell goods or services in a specific location are required to file for a vendor permit.
How to fill out vendorpermit?
To fill out a vendor permit, individuals or businesses must provide information about the goods or services they plan to sell, their contact information, and payment for the permit fee.
What is the purpose of vendorpermit?
The purpose of a vendor permit is to regulate and monitor the sale of goods or services in a specific location, ensuring that vendors comply with local laws and regulations.
What information must be reported on vendorpermit?
Information such as the type of goods or services being sold, the location where sales will take place, contact information, and payment for the permit fee must be reported on a vendor permit.
